Role Description The Junior Architect will support senior architects in developing design concepts, preparing drawings, and coordinating project documentation. Day-to-day tasks include creating and revising architectural plans, assisting with 3D models and presentations, and ensuring design details align with project requirements and local regulations. The role involves collaborating with internal team members, consultants, and contractors, participating in site visits, and contributing to design reviews and project meetings. This is a full-time, on-site role based in Dehradun, requiring regular presence at the office and project locations.
